The Spark Behind Our Chelsea Garden

Sometimes, the most extraordinary ideas begin in the most ordinary moments. For us, it started with a message from Emily Plane - a beautiful, bright light who was treated by our Medical Director, Professor John Butler, and loved deeply by our founders.

After visiting the Chelsea Flower Show in 2023, Emily sent a note that stopped us in our tracks. She’d seen a garden created for a hospital and wrote about how powerful it felt - how she imagined something similar could transform the experience for women going through treatment at The Royal Marsden. She remembered sitting in their garden years before and wishing it was a place that truly brought calm and comfort. “I just can’t stop thinking about how much joy and calmness it would bring patients,” she wrote.

Emily’s message planted a seed. Though she is no longer with us, her words stayed in our hearts and quietly grew. Two years later, they have blossomed into something truly special - the Lady Garden Foundation’s first ever Chelsea Flower Show garden, a space that celebrates women’s strength, health, and resilience.

This garden is for every woman, like Emily, whose courage inspires change.
